Right-Wing Influencer's Fraud Claims Spark California Voting Debate
2/20/2026
1 of 1
Story summary
- Shirley, a right-wing influencer, released a video alleging California's voting system is rife with fraud.
- A whistleblower accompanies Shirley and cites registration discrepancies, including ages and addresses.
- The California Secretary of State's office dismissed the claims, stating the video lacks evidence and noting that a Republican committed voter fraud.
- The controversy coincides with Republican efforts to pass the SAVE Act, which would require citizenship proof for voter registration.
